Position SummaryCVS Health is recruiting for an Executive Director, Payor Product Growth Spend who will implement organizational strategy for products, standards, infrastructure, and availability to support membership goals. This incumbent will lead departments in the end-to-end development, management, and analysis of key account products and offerings, as well as develop methodologies to create new product ideation and enhancement.

You’ll make an impact:

  • Leading area processes for the organization's Product Management and Development area, and ensures methods align with the overall business strategy.

  • Formulating organizational policies, goals, and objectives based on best practices in the field.

  • Establishing strategic direction, simplification, and integration of the organization's product portfolio.

  • Designing the annual operating plan and 3–5-year product strategy.

  • Administering product pipeline development to address industry trends and regulations.

  • Advising management on market and competitive analysis to inform strategic decision making and key positioning.

  • Developing strategic relationships with department leaders to align cross functional product development and management initiatives.

  • Managing team performance through regular, timely feedback as well as the formal performance review process to ensure delivery of exceptional services and engagement, motivation, and team development.

  • Supporting CVS Health in attracting, retaining, and engaging a diverse and inclusive consumer-centric workforce that delivers on our purpose and reflects the communities in which we work, live, and serve.

Pay Range

The typical pay range for this role is:

$131,500.00 - $303,200.00

This pay range represents the base hourly rate or base annual full-time salary for all positions in the job grade within which this position falls. The actual base salary offer will depend on a variety of factors including experience, education, geography and other relevant factors. This position is eligible for a CVS Health bonus, commission or short-term incentive program in addition to the base pay range listed above. This position also includes an award target in the company’s equity award program. In addition to your compensation, enjoy the rewards of an organization that puts our heart into caring for our colleagues and our communities. The Company offers a full range of medical, dental, and vision benefits. Eligible employees may enroll in the Company’s 401(k) retirement savings plan, and an Employee Stock Purchase Plan is also available for eligible employees. The Company provides a fully-paid term life insurance plan to eligible employees, and short-term and long term disability benefits. CVS Health also offers numerous well-being programs, education assistance, free development courses, a CVS store discount, and discount programs with participating partners. As for time off, Company employees enjoy Paid Time Off (“PTO”) or vacation pay, as well as paid holidays throughout the calendar year. Number of paid holidays, sick time and other time off are provided consistent with relevant state law and Company policies.
